forked from saurabh/orbit4-5
update design for authorization module
This commit is contained in:
parent
c76b65d149
commit
1681e6671b
|
@ -17,8 +17,23 @@
|
||||||
.mini-layout .mini-layout-sidebar .pane {
|
.mini-layout .mini-layout-sidebar .pane {
|
||||||
right: 0px;
|
right: 0px;
|
||||||
}
|
}
|
||||||
|
.mini-layout .nav-tabs {
|
||||||
|
margin-bottom: 0;
|
||||||
|
}
|
||||||
|
.mini-layout .tab-pane {
|
||||||
|
padding: 20px 10px;
|
||||||
|
background-color: #fff;
|
||||||
|
border: 1px solid #ddd;
|
||||||
|
border-top: none;
|
||||||
|
}
|
||||||
|
.mini-layout .tab-pane-head {
|
||||||
|
border-bottom: 1px solid #ddd;
|
||||||
|
}
|
||||||
|
.mini-layout .tab-pane-head select {
|
||||||
|
margin: 5px;
|
||||||
|
}
|
||||||
.checkbox-card {
|
.checkbox-card {
|
||||||
margin: 0;
|
margin: 1em 0 0;
|
||||||
}
|
}
|
||||||
.checkbox-card li {
|
.checkbox-card li {
|
||||||
position: relative;
|
position: relative;
|
||||||
|
|
|
@ -16,18 +16,29 @@
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<div class="mini-layout-body span10">
|
<div class="mini-layout-body span10">
|
||||||
<%= link_to t(:module_authorization), admin_authorizations_path(@module_app.key) if @module_app.authorizable %>
|
<ul class="nav nav-tabs">
|
||||||
<% @module_app.authorizable_models.each do |authorizable_model| %>
|
<li class="active">
|
||||||
<%= link_to (authorizable_model.eql?('Category') ? t(:category_auth) : "#{authorizable_model.underscore.humanize.capitalize} #{t(:authorization_)}"), admin_authorizations_path(@module_app.key, type: "#{authorizable_model.underscore}_authorization") %>
|
<%= link_to t(:module_authorization), admin_authorizations_path(@module_app.key), :class => "active" if @module_app.authorizable %>
|
||||||
<% end %>
|
</li>
|
||||||
<% if @error %>
|
<li>
|
||||||
<%= @error %>
|
<% @module_app.authorizable_models.each do |authorizable_model| %>
|
||||||
<% else %>
|
<%= link_to (authorizable_model.eql?('Category') ? t(:category_auth) : "#{authorizable_model.underscore.humanize.capitalize} #{t(:authorization_)}"), admin_authorizations_path(@module_app.key, type: "#{authorizable_model.underscore}_authorization") %>
|
||||||
<%= select_tag @type.underscore.humanize, options_from_collection_for_select(@objects, "id", "title", @object.id), :onchange => "window.location.href = '/admin/authorizations/'+'#{@module_app.key}/#{@type}/'+$(this).val();" if @objects %>
|
<% end %>
|
||||||
<ul id="card-list" class="checkbox-card clearfix">
|
</li>
|
||||||
<%= render partial: 'user', collection: @authorizations %>
|
</ul>
|
||||||
</ul>
|
<div class="tab-pane">
|
||||||
<% end %>
|
<% if @error %>
|
||||||
|
<%= @error %>
|
||||||
|
<% else %>
|
||||||
|
<div class="tab-pane-head clearfix">
|
||||||
|
<h4 class="pull-left">Title</h4>
|
||||||
|
<%= select_tag @type.underscore.humanize, options_from_collection_for_select(@objects, "id", "title", @object.id), :class => "pull-right", :onchange => "window.location.href = '/admin/authorizations/'+'#{@module_app.key}/#{@type}/'+$(this).val();" if @objects %>
|
||||||
|
</div>
|
||||||
|
<ul id="card-list" class="checkbox-card clearfix">
|
||||||
|
<%= render partial: 'user', collection: @authorizations %>
|
||||||
|
</ul>
|
||||||
|
<% end %>
|
||||||
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ue